SOURCE: Hard reset for a HTC TyTn
There are two ways:
1.
Press and hold the two soft keys (the ones with dashes on) and at the same time insert the stylus in the soft reset hole. All three things need to be done together and a warning will appear. (it is a bit fiddly)
2
Go to Start>Settings>System (Tab)>Clear Storage (Icon)

SOURCE: How do I reset my htc 8925?
Press and hold both soft-keys [they look like minus signs] while putting a paper-clip or something in the reset hole located near the usb port.

SOURCE: want to factory reset an unlocked htc touch cdma (vogue)
All you have to do is...
hold down the (RED) End button and the (GREEN) Send button at the same time, and while still holding them down POKE your stylus in the soft reset hole at the bottom of phone.
Soft Reset button is located to the right of the mini USB charging port, assuming the phone's screen is facing you.
Confirm you want to Format and Done!
P.S.
Sometimes if you don't hold the Green and Red buttons hard enough they tend to unclick and reclick if you don't apply Firm and even pressure.
Also if you still have trouble make sure the phone is in the BOOTING cycle when you attempt this.
